Market Dynamics

The price of 1 BTC is determined by the supply and demand dynamics in the cryptocurrency market. When demand for BTC increases, its price tends to rise, and vice versa. Here are some key factors that influence the market dynamics:

Factor Description
Market Sentiment Investor confidence and sentiment can greatly impact the price of BTC. Positive news, such as increased adoption or regulatory support, can drive up the price, while negative news, such as regulatory crackdowns or security breaches, can lead to a decline.
Supply and Demand The limited supply of BTC, with a maximum of 21 million coins, creates scarcity, which can drive up the price. Conversely, if there is an excess supply or a decrease in demand, the price may fall.
Market Trends Long-term trends, such as the rise of decentralized finance (DeFi) or institutional adoption, can positively impact the price of BTC. Short-term trends, such as pump-and-dump schemes, can be more volatile.

Factors Affecting Price Fluctuations

Several factors can cause the price of 1 BTC to fluctuate. Here are some of the most significant ones:

  • Regulatory Changes: Governments around the world are still figuring out how to regulate cryptocurrencies. Changes in regulations can have a significant impact on the price of BTC.
  • Technological Developments: Innovations in blockchain technology, such as the development of new cryptocurrencies or improvements in the Bitcoin network, can influence the price of BTC.
  • Market Manipulation: Like any other financial market, the cryptocurrency market is susceptible to manipulation. Pump-and-dump schemes, where traders artificially inflate the price of a cryptocurrency, can lead to significant price volatility.
